#3eac3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3eac3e is composed of 24.3% red, 67.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 0% magenta, 64%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 45.9%. #3eac3e color hex could be obtained by blending #7cff7c with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#3eac3e color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#3eac3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3eac3e has RGB values of R:62, G:172,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4107326.
